1. Traditional Bunk Beds
These classic designs feature 2 beds stacked on top of each other. They are offered in various materials, consisting of wood and metal, offering sturdiness and timeless aesthetic appeals.
2. Loft Beds
Loft beds raise the sleeping location, leaving space beneath for a desk, play area, or additional storage. This style is perfect for teenagers or young people who require a research study space in their room.
3. L-Shaped Bunk Beds
L-shaped bunk beds feature one bed positioned horizontally and another vertically. This design can create a cozy nook and frequently includes additional functions like a futon or desk beneath the lofted bed.
4. Triple Bunk Beds
Perfect for bigger households or pajama parties, triple bunk beds stack 3 beds vertically. These are generally utilized in larger spaces or special accommodations where extra sleeping plans are necessary.
5. Bunk Beds with Storage
These beds come integrated with drawers or shelves to make the most of storage. They are ideal for smaller rooms where additional storage services are needed, such as toys, clothes, or books.

1. Solid Wood
Understood for its sturdiness and visual appeal, solid wood bunk beds are typically chosen for their sturdiness and timeless look. Nevertheless, they can be heavier and more pricey.
2. Metal
Metal bunk beds are light-weight and frequently more cost effective than wood options. They supply a contemporary appearance and are simpler to move, however they might not be as long lasting as solid wood.
3. Engineered Wood
Engineered wood beds integrate a wood veneer with particleboard or MDF for a cost-efficient option. They are readily available in numerous surfaces and can mimic the appearance of solid wood while being lighter.
4. Upholstered
Some modern bunk beds come upholstered in fabric or faux leather, including a softer aesthetic. These are frequently utilized in stylish children's rooms and playrooms.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: Are bunk beds safe for kids?
Yes, bunk beds are normally safe for kids when appropriately created and preserved. Ensure the bed has safety features like guardrails and a strong ladder.
Q2: How much weight can a bunk bed hold?
Many bunk beds can hold in between 200-400 pounds per bed, however it's crucial to refer to the producer's requirements for precise weight limits.
Q3: Can bunk beds be utilized for adults?
Yes, numerous modern bunk beds are designed to accommodate adults. Look for ones with higher weight capacities and durable building and constructions.
Q4: Do bunk beds need unique bed mattress?
Bunk beds generally need twin or full-sized mattresses. Ensure the bed mattress works with the bunk's design and height.
Q5: How do I preserve a bunk bed?
Routine upkeep includes inspecting for loose bolts or screws, cleaning up the surface areas frequently, and inspecting for wear and tear to guarantee longevity.
